Craig Mason Tied for Second at William & Mary Invitational

March 24, 2003

FAIRFAX, Va. - George Mason junior Craig Mason (Lorton, VA/Hayfield) is tied for second in the individual standings following the first day of competition at the William & Mary Invitational held at the 6,781-yard, par 71 Kingsmill Resort River Course in Williamsburg, VA.

Due to darkness on Monday evening, the second round was not completed. The second round will continue Tuesday morning at 8:30 a.m., with the third round following completion of the second round. The George Mason men's team is 12th overall in the first round of the tournament, which features 18 teams from the Mid-Atlantic District. The Patriots fired a team score of 310. They sit ahead of W&M's "B" team by one stroke and trail Towson by two strokes. James Madison holds the lead at 298, followed by Liberty (299) and Richmond (302).

Patriot sophomore Ryan Jeun (Laurel, MD/DeMatha) is tied for 35th out of 96 individuals after carding a 77. Junior Ben Hogan (Centreville, VA/Centreville) is tied for 54th (79), while seniors Chris Barr (Springfield, VA/West Springfield) and Carl Jacobson (Moline, IL/Moline) are tied for 75th, shooting 82 in the first round.

The individual standings have Navy's Billy Hurley leading with a three under-par 68. Mason is tied with three other players for second in St. John's Andrew Svoboda, Maryland's Tim Kane, and Towson's Billy Wingerd. Each of them fired a one-over 72 in the first round.

Action at the William & Mary Invitational concludes Tuesday with the second and third rounds.

1st Round, William & Mary Invitational, 6,781 yard, Par 71, Kingsmill Resort River Course:

Top Teams 1. James Madison 298; 2. Liberty 299; 3. Richmond 302; T4. William & Mary "A" team 303, Georgetown 303; 6. Elon 304

Top Individuals 1. Billy Hurley, Navy 68 (-3); T2. Craig Mason, George Mason 72 (+1), Andrew Svododa, St. John's 72 (+1) Tim Kane, Maryland 72 (+1), Billy Wingerd, Towson (+1)

George Mason Individuals T2- Craig Mason 72; T35- Ryan Jeun 77; T54- Ben Hogan 79; T75- Chris Barr 82; T75- Carl Jacobson 82
